Northwell Health is seeking a highly motivated Registered Nurse (RN) to join our Labor & Delivery team at North Shore University Hospital. As a Registered Nurse (RN) in Labor & Delivery you will be providing evidence-based and patient-centered care in a high-volume setting. This is a Full-time Day Shift position, that includes rotating weekends.

Qualifications:

Bachelor's of Science Degree in Nursing, preferred

Must be a graduate from an accredited school of Nursing

Currently licensed as a Registered Professional Nurse in New York State

BLS and ACLS required

NRP required for Labor and Delivery, and Mother/Baby RN's

Completion of specialty certification preferred (RNC-OB/NIC, CCRN)

Two years acute care nursing experience, preferred
